  • Abstract
    Organizations whose work force consists of `trainees´ on the one hand and `regular employees´ on the other (e.g. nontenured versus tenured faculty) are considered. A model which allows direct recruitment into both grades and assumes seniority dependent promotion policy and resignation patterns is formulated. Formulas for actual promotion and resignation densities are then derived. The model is used to predict time-dependent expected grad size trajectories as a function of recruitment patterns. Specifying promotion and resignation densities, we derive quantities of interest for two different types of organizations, one in continuous and the other in discrete time. Illustrative numerical examples are provided for these special cases.
